Polar Bears and their Cubs are invited to join Ponca City families to kick off the winter season with the Park and Recreation Department!

Meet at the Lake Ponca Ski Doc No. 13 for  the first annual Polar Bear Plunge at 1 p.m. Dec. 9 for a chilly good romp in the water! You can enjoy the refreshing dip FREE!

For a souvenir 2017 Polar Bear Plunge beach towel for $10, register online at https://Polar Plunge Towel. After the plunge,  you’re invited to warm up and get ready for hibernation with hot refreshments and cookies.

The Park and Recreation Department offers these sensible safety tips to  make the plunge as fun and safe as possible:

  • Anyone with heart problems—Just watch
  • Do not drink—Alcohol speeds up hypothermia
  • Do not stay in the water longer than 15 minutes
  • Do not remove clothing until swim time
  • Don’t put dry clothing on over wet clothing
